Children's Responses to Moral and Social Conventional Transgressions in Free-Play Settings.
Nucci, Larry P.; Nucci, Maria Santiago
Child Development, v53 n5 p1337-42 Oct 1982
Children ages 7 to 10 and 11 to 14 years of age responded to both moral and conventional forms of transgression. Responses to moral transgressions revolved around intrinsic consequences of acts upon victims, while responses to conventional breaches focused on aspects of the social order. Sex differences were found. (Author/MP)
